It is possible that it is a 420 stainless blade, that was simply engraved with S30V on it...

FWIW, after closely looking at the pics in the OP, methinks that this is VERY likely.

The opening slot (cutout) tells the tale:

http://www.equipped.org/pp/pic1362.htm
http://www.equipped.org/lm_charge-wave.htm ("The Blades" heading, 3rd paragraph)

"The opening slot on the Charge 154CM plain edge blade is larger than that of the Wave. This is because the rough Charge blade is laser cut while the Wave blade is fine blanked (stamped out of sheet). The laser cutting allows them to get closer to the edge of the blade."

The (true) S30V blade has the same larger hole/cutout as the 154CM:



So, bad news is, this seems to be a regular 420 blade that's been wrongly ID'd. GOOD news is, it's still an "error" (from a collector's viewpoint), and whatever value it may have probably wasn't THAT compromised by unpackaging it.
